Java中static final与final的不同。

 我来答
最绅士的痞子灬
2018-04-18 · TA获得超过2.9万个赞
知道小有建树答主
回答量:146
采纳率:100%
帮助的人:2.4万
展开全部

1、final可以修饰:属性,方法,类,局部变量(方法中的变量)

2、final修饰的属性的初始化可以在编译期,也可以在运行期,初始化后不能被改变。

3、final修饰的属性跟具体对象有关,在运行期初始化的final属性,不同对象可以有不同的值。

4、final修饰的属性表明是一个常数(创建后不能被修改)。

5、final修饰的方法表示该方法在子类中不能被重写,final修饰的类表示该类不能被继承。

6、对于基本类型数据,final会将值变为一个常数(创建后不能被修改);但是对于对象句柄(亦可称作引用或者指针),final会将句柄变为一个常数(进行声明时,必须将句柄初始化到一个具体的对象。而且不能再将句柄指向另一个对象。

7、但是,对象的本身是可以修改的。这一限制也适用于数组,数组也属于对象,数组本身也是可以修改的。方法参数中的final句柄,意味着在该方法内部,我们不能改变参数句柄指向的实际东西,也就是说在方法内部不能给形参句柄再另外赋值)。

qyq592140
2018-04-07 · TA获得超过9811个赞
知道小有建树答主
回答量:106
采纳率:100%
帮助的人:3万
展开全部

1、在打开的ie浏览器窗口右上方点击齿轮图标,选择“Internet选项”,如下图所示:

2、在打开的Internet选项窗口中,切换到安全栏,在安全选卡中点击“自定义级别”,如下图所示:

3、在“安全设置-Internet 区域”界面找到“Java 小程序脚本”、“活动脚本”,并将这两个选项都选择为“禁用”,然后点击确定,如下图所示:

已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式